#include "paddle/fluid/framework/details/reduce_blockop_handle.h" | ||
#include "paddle/fluid/framework/details/container_cast.h" | ||
#include "paddle/fluid/framework/details/reduce_and_gather.h" | ||
#include "paddle/fluid/framework/details/variable_visitor.h" | ||
|
||
namespace paddle { | ||
namespace framework { | ||
namespace details { | ||
|
||
void ReduceBlockOpHandle::RunImpl() { | ||
if (places_.size() == 1) return; | ||
|
||
WaitInputVarGenerated(); | ||
|
||
auto in_var_handles = DynamicCast<VarHandle>(inputs_); | ||
auto out_var_handles = DynamicCast<VarHandle>(outputs_); | ||
|
||
PADDLE_ENFORCE_EQ(in_var_handles.size(), | ||
places_.size() * out_var_handles.size(), | ||
"The number of input and output is not consistent."); | ||
|
||
#ifdef PADDLE_WITH_CUDA | ||
std::vector<const LoDTensor *> lod_tensors = GetInputValues(); | ||
auto type = lod_tensors[0]->type(); | ||
auto numel = lod_tensors[0]->numel(); | ||
std::vector<std::function<void()>> nccl_reduce_calls; | ||
auto root_dev_id = | ||
boost::get<platform::CUDAPlace>(places_[dst_scope_id_]).device; | ||
for (size_t i = 0; i < local_scopes_.size(); ++i) { | ||
int dev_id = | ||
boost::get<platform::CUDAPlace>(lod_tensors[i]->place()).device; | ||
auto &nccl_ctx = nccl_ctxs_->at(dev_id); | ||
|
||
void *buffer = const_cast<void *>(lod_tensors[i]->data<void>()); | ||
void *recvbuffer = nullptr; | ||
if (i == dst_scope_id_) { | ||
auto reduce_var = local_scopes_[dst_scope_id_]->FindVar(var_name_); | ||
recvbuffer = reduce_var->GetMutable<framework::LoDTensor>()->mutable_data( | ||
lod_tensors[dst_scope_id_]->place()); | ||
} | ||
|
||
int nccl_type = platform::ToNCCLDataType(type); | ||
nccl_reduce_calls.emplace_back( | ||
[buffer, recvbuffer, nccl_type, numel, root_dev_id, &nccl_ctx] { | ||
PADDLE_ENFORCE(platform::dynload::ncclReduce( | ||
buffer, recvbuffer, numel, static_cast<ncclDataType_t>(nccl_type), | ||
ncclSum, root_dev_id, nccl_ctx.comm_, nccl_ctx.stream())); | ||
}); | ||
} | ||
#endif | ||
|
||
std::vector<const Scope *> var_scopes; | ||
for (auto *s : local_scopes_) { | ||
auto var = s->FindVar(kLocalExecScopeName); | ||
PADDLE_ENFORCE_NOT_NULL(var); | ||
var_scopes.emplace_back(var->Get<Scope *>()); | ||
} | ||
|
||
// Reduce the variable which is in CPU side. | ||
std::vector<std::vector<const LoDTensor *>> cpu_lod_tensors; | ||
std::vector<Variable *> cpu_out_vars; | ||
for (auto out_var_h : out_var_handles) { | ||
auto out_var = var_scopes[dst_scope_id_]->FindVar(out_var_h->name_); | ||
PADDLE_ENFORCE_NOT_NULL(out_var); | ||
|
||
if (platform::is_cpu_place(out_var->Get<LoDTensor>().place())) { | ||
std::vector<const LoDTensor *> lod_tensors; | ||
for (size_t i = 0; i < places_.size(); ++i) { | ||
lod_tensors.emplace_back( | ||
&(var_scopes[i]->FindVar(out_var_h->name_)->Get<LoDTensor>())); | ||
PADDLE_ENFORCE(platform::is_cpu_place(lod_tensors.back()->place())); | ||
} | ||
|
||
cpu_lod_tensors.push_back(lod_tensors); | ||
cpu_out_vars.push_back(out_var); | ||
} | ||
} | ||
#ifdef PADDLE_WITH_CUDA | ||
this->RunAndRecordEvent([&] { | ||
{ | ||
platform::NCCLGroupGuard guard; | ||
for (auto &call : nccl_reduce_calls) { | ||
call(); | ||
} | ||
} | ||
for (size_t i = 0; i < cpu_lod_tensors.size(); ++i) { | ||
ReduceLoDTensor func(cpu_lod_tensors[i], | ||
cpu_out_vars[i]->GetMutable<framework::LoDTensor>()); | ||
VisitDataType(ToDataType(cpu_lod_tensors[i][0]->type()), func); | ||
} | ||
}); | ||
#endif | ||
} | ||
|
||
std::vector<const LoDTensor *> ReduceBlockOpHandle::GetInputValues() { | ||
std::vector<const LoDTensor *> lod_tensors; | ||
|
||
auto &value_0 = GetInputValue(0); | ||
lod_tensors.emplace_back(&value_0); | ||
|
||
std::unordered_set<int> dev_id_set; | ||
auto dev_id = boost::get<platform::CUDAPlace>(value_0.place()).device; | ||
dev_id_set.insert(dev_id); | ||
|
||
for (size_t i = 1; i < local_scopes_.size(); ++i) { | ||
auto &value = GetInputValue(i); | ||
PADDLE_ENFORCE_EQ(value_0.type(), value.type()); | ||
PADDLE_ENFORCE_EQ(value_0.numel(), value.numel()); | ||
lod_tensors.emplace_back(&value); | ||
|
||
auto dev_id = boost::get<platform::CUDAPlace>(value.place()).device; | ||
if (dev_id_set.count(dev_id)) { | ||
PADDLE_THROW("dev_%d has been in dev_id_set.", dev_id); | ||
} | ||
dev_id_set.insert(dev_id); | ||
} | ||
return lod_tensors; | ||
} | ||
|
||
const LoDTensor &ReduceBlockOpHandle::GetInputValue(size_t idx) { | ||
auto reduce_var = local_scopes_.at(idx)->FindVar(var_name_); | ||
PADDLE_ENFORCE_NOT_NULL(reduce_var, "%s is not found.", var_name_); | ||
auto &lod_tensor = reduce_var->Get<LoDTensor>(); | ||
PADDLE_ENFORCE(platform::is_gpu_place(lod_tensor.place())); | ||
return lod_tensor; | ||
} | ||
|
||
std::string ReduceBlockOpHandle::Name() const { return "reduce_block"; } | ||
} // namespace details | ||
} // namespace framework | ||
} // namespace paddle |
